E.{Mr Elliott - Chief Engineer} from Hs.{Lord Ernest Hives - Chair} X4387 Hs{Lord Ernest Hives - Chair}5/LG29.12.21. EXHAUST HEATED THROTTLE AND PILOT JET. X4305 X4387 There are one or two points to be cleared up in connection with this scheme. One is the connection for the petrol pipe leading from the float chamber to the pilot jet. When we dispensed with the primer we can then do with an ordinary elbow fixed into the float chamber. We recommend that this elbow should extend into the float chamber so that sediment cannot drain into it. We have also found it necessary to arrange the return pipe for the exhaust gases from the throttle in the front silencer so that the pipe extends into the centre tube. We can then obtain an ejector effect. You will realise that at full throttle low speeds, we have got to do all we can to entice the gases to pass round the throttle or else we are going to have much less heat on the throttle than with the hot water. We are arranging that this connection is made in this way. We have also not yet received the lettering to go on to the Indicator plate on the Instrument Board. We should be pleased if you could settle up these points because we are getting a set ready to send to Springfield and we should like it to be complete X4327 GOSHAWK 11.
